Before you do the following make sure you have the .NET Framework installed. This is free from Microsoft, to see if you have it installed, go to Add/Remove Programs and see if its in the list. If it isnt run Windows Update and I believe it appears as one of the options. If not, just Google it, you will find it. The following absolutely will not work if the .NET Framework is not installed, so do this first.
Grab this file:
(1) Extract the file.
(2) Browse to portDump\bin\Debug
(3) Open portDump.exe.config in Notepad or any text editor
(4) Change the port to whatever you have set in your switch
(5) Change the ip to whatever the ip is of your local machine (ie. the ip you set the host to in the switch)
(6) Save the file you just edited and close it.
(7) Run portDump.exe
You should get a box that pops up, just wait and it will start to populate with cdr report information.
Once it starts capturing data the my-billing.txt file will populate with data in the portDump\bin\Debug\output folder as well as the portdump.mdb access database in the portDump\bin\Debug\ folder.
